What the analysis found

Positioning

The logo's bold red and direct typography clearly position KFC as an energetic, accessible fast-food brand. It aligns well with the industry's need for quick recognition and appetite stimulation, though its simplicity might not convey premium quality, which is consistent with its market segment.

Trust

The established nature of the KFC brand, combined with the logo's clear and unambiguous presentation, contributes to a moderate-to-high trust score. Its familiarity and consistent visual identity over time foster a sense of reliability, despite the lack of overt 'competence' cues in the design itself.

Recognition

With its simple, high-contrast design and iconic red color, the logo achieves exceptional recognition speed and memorability. The distinct custom typeface ensures it stands out, making it instantly identifiable even at a glance, which is a significant asset in a competitive market.

Emotion

The dominant red color powerfully triggers emotions of excitement, hunger, and urgency, which are highly desirable for a fast-food brand. The rounded, bold letterforms also evoke a sense of comfort and familiarity, contributing to a strong emotional connection with consumers seeking satisfying, accessible food.

Design

The logo exhibits high design quality in terms of simplicity, scalability, and figure-ground balance. Its minimalist approach ensures it adapts well to various applications. However, the color contrast ratio fails WCAG standards, indicating a design flaw in terms of universal accessibility.

Brand personality

ExcitementThe Everyman

The KFC logo's brand personality is predominantly 'Excitement' (85/100) due to its vibrant red color and dynamic italicized typography, conveying energy, daring, and a spirited attitude. 'Competence' (60/100) is moderately present, stemming from the brand's established history and the logo's clear, direct communication, suggesting reliability. 'Sincerity' (55/100) is also moderate, hinted at by the rounded, approachable letterforms and the 'homely' and 'wholesome' associations from the Kobayashi scale, suggesting a down-to-earth quality. 'Sophistication' (30/100) and 'Ruggedness' (25/100) are low, as the design prioritizes broad appeal and fast-food accessibility over luxury or outdoorsy toughness.

The logo embodies 'The Everyman' archetype through its approachable, familiar, and unpretentious design. The bold, rounded, and simple typography, combined with the universally recognized red, suggests a brand that is down-to-earth, reliable, and accessible to everyone. It doesn't aim for exclusivity or sophistication but rather for comfort and belonging, resonating with everyday people seeking simple pleasures.

Color and typography

Primary color reads as energy, hunger, passion, excitement, urgency

The vibrant, saturated red of the KFC logo has a strong emotional impact, primarily stimulating feelings of energy, excitement, and hunger. Red is known to increase heart rate and metabolism, making it highly effective for a food brand. It also conveys passion and urgency, encouraging quick decisions and immediate gratification.

The bold, italicized sans-serif font perfectly matches KFC's brand personality as an energetic, fast-paced, and approachable fast-food chain. The strong, confident letterforms convey reliability and impact, while the italicization adds dynamism, aligning with the brand's promise of quick and satisfying service.
